Object Desktop keeps reinstalling

Object desktop keeps popping up wanting me to login.  As far as I can see, everything in the software column says Try or Buy. I do not recall ever purchasing this and it doesn't show in my dashboard. 

I keep uninstalling it and stardock keeps reinstalling it. How do I get rid of it?

Reply #7 Top

Hello,

Sorry to hear you are having trouble.

It might be a Stardock Central (really old) installation?  Uninstall both Stardock Central and Object Desktop.  If Object desktop still pops up, you may need to use Task Manager to Open the File location to see where the app is actually installed and manually delete the folder.

Reply #9 Top

@sdRohan, during followup in the other thread, I found that it was SDC detecting an update and installing Object Desktop instead. That Object Desktop seems to have the bug where it reopens the window regularly.

So indeed, one work around is to uninstall SDC so it stops installing OD, then uninstall OD one last time if it's installed.

Since I have done this, I haven't had any more of these popups. 

Of course it means I don't have that central manager for Stardock software anymore (either of them) but the individual products seem to have their own update checks anyway, at least the ones I'm using.
